Output 531039d73dc16eb3aa56464e03c65d0ee5f34a480d23670061798be936583c58:1

value
15849156
script pubkey
OP_0 OP_PUSHBYTES_20 e90e0e059066554f62b8159806e0ce0f8561127f
address
bc1qay8qupvsve257c4czkvqdcxwp7zkzynlm4z2tu
transaction
531039d73dc16eb3aa56464e03c65d0ee5f34a480d23670061798be936583c58
confirmations
110389
spent
true